Mercyhurst Falls 79-70 at Long Island in NEC Men's Basketball Championship

Long Island University secured the Northeast Conference's automatic NCAA bid by reaching the final, as Mercyhurst is ineligible during its Division I transition.

  • On March 10, 2026, Long Island University, the Sharks, defeated Mercyhurst 79-70 to claim the NEC title, securing an NCAA Tournament spot.
  • Given the conference's eligibility rules, Long Island clinched the NCAA bid after reaching the final on March 7, before Mercyhurst's ineligibility was known, making the automatic spot settled early.
  • Malachi Davis and Greg Gordon each scored 24 points for Long Island University, with Davis' 3-pointer and layup at 4:02 giving the Sharks a lead they kept, shooting 56%.
  • Long Island became the first official 2026 NCAA qualifier after its March 7 semifinal win, and the Northeast Conference had determined its NCAA representative before the March 10, 2026 title game tipoff.
  • Because Mercyhurst won't be eligible until 2027-28, NCAA transition rules leave other NEC programs like Le Moyne and the Dolphins ineligible through their own timelines.

With ticket punched, Davis and Gordon reinforce NCAA bid beating Mercyhurst in NEC finale

Malachi Davis and Greg Gordon each scored 24 points and Long Island University beat Mercyhurst 79-70 to claim the NEC title.
